Understanding Blue Light and Its Effects on Our Eyes

Blue light is a component of the visible light spectrum, with wavelengths ranging from 380 to 500 nanometers. Its high-energy, short-wavelength properties enable it to penetrate the eye more effectively than other visible light, potentially leading to increased eye strain and fatigue. Here are some common issues associated with excessive blue light exposure:

  • Digital Eye Strain: Spending prolonged periods in front of digital screens can lead to digital eye strain, characterized by symptoms such as dry eyes, blurred vision, headaches, and neck or shoulder pain.
  • Disrupted Sleep Patterns: Exposure to blue light in the evenings can interfere with the natural production of melatonin, the hormone responsible for regulating our sleep-wake cycle, resulting in poor sleep quality and daytime fatigue.
  • Potential Long-Term Effects: While more research is needed, some studies suggest that chronic exposure to blue light may contribute to age-related macular degeneration, a leading cause of vision loss in older adults.

Lifestyle Adjustments for Minimizing Blue Light Exposure

In addition to our protective eyewear, several lifestyle adjustments can help minimize the effects of blue light on your eyes and overall well-being:

  • Follow the 20-20-20 Rule: To reduce digital eye strain, take a 20-second break to look at an object at least 20 feet away every 20 minutes while using digital devices.
  • Adjust Display Settings: Modify the brightness, contrast, and font size on your devices’ screens to enhance visual comfort during extended use.
  • Create a Sleep-Friendly Environment: Limit blue light exposure in the evenings by keeping electronic devices out of the bedroom and adopting a screen-free bedtime routine.
